Enabling Android Location Services

Android 10 & 11
Swipe down from the top of the screen.
Touch and hold Location. If you don’t see Location tap Edit (Pencil icon) or Settings (Cogwheel). Drag Location into your Quick Settings.
To turn your phone’s location accuracy on:
Swipe down from the top of the screen.
Touch and hold Location.
Tap Advanced Google > Location Accuracy.
Turn Improve Location Accuracy on or off.

Android 9.0
Open your device’s Settings app.
Tap Security & Location > Location.
- If you have a work profile, tap Advanced.
Then, choose an option:
- Turn Location on or off: Tap Location.
- Scan for nearby networks: Tap Advanced Scanning. Turn Wi-Fi scanning or Bluetooth scanning on or off.
- Turn emergency location service on or off: Tap Advanced Google Emergency Location Service. Turn Emergency Location Service on or off.

Android 4.4 to 8.1
Open your phone’s Settings app.
Tap Security & Location Location. If you don’t see “Security & Location,” tap Location.
Tap Mode. Then pick:
High accuracy: Use GPS, Wi-Fi, mobile networks, and sensors to get the most accurate location. Use Google Location Services to help estimate your phone’s location faster and more accurately.
Battery saving: Use sources that use less battery, like Wi-Fi and mobile networks. Use Google Location Services to help estimate your phone’s location faster and more accurately.
Device only: Use only GPS. Don’t use Google Location Services to provide location information. This can estimate your phone’s location more slowly and use more battery.

Android 4.1 to 4.3
Open your phone’s Settings app.
Under “Personal,” tap Location access.
At the top of the screen, turn Access to my location on or off.
When location access is on, pick either or both of:
- GPS satellites: Lets your phone estimate its location from satellite signals, like a GPS device in a car.
- Wi-Fi & mobile network location: Lets your phone use Google Location Services to help estimate its location faster, with or without GPS.
When location access is off: Your phone can’t find its precise location or share it with any apps.
